Belmont /********************************************************************* ap_dsk35.c Apple 3.5" disk images This code supports 3.5" 400k/800k disks used in early Macintoshes and the Apple IIgs, and 3.5" 1440k MFM disks used on most Macintoshes. These disks have the following properties: 400k: 80 tracks, 1 head 800k: 80 tracks, 2 heads Tracks 0-15 have 12 sectors each Tracks 16-31 have 11 sectors each Tracks 32-47 have 10 sectors each Tracks 48-63 have 9 sectors each Tracks 64-79 have 8 sectors each 1440k disks are simply 80 tracks, 2 heads and 18 sectors per track. Each sector on 400/800k disks has 524 bytes, 512 of which are really used by the Macintosh (80 tracks) * (avg of 10 sectors) * (512 bytes) * (2 sides) = 800 kB Data is nibblized : 3 data bytes -> 4 bytes on disk. In addition to 512 logical bytes, each sector contains 800 physical bytes. Here is the layout of the physical sector: Pos 0 0xFF (pad byte where head is turned on ???) 1-35 self synch 0xFFs (7*5) (42 bytes actually written to media) 36 0xD5 37 0xAA 38 0x96 39 diskbytes[(track number) & 0x3F] 40 diskbytes[(sector number)] 41 diskbytes[("side")] 42 diskbytes[("format byte")] 43 diskbytes[("sum")] 44 0xDE 45 0xAA 46 pad byte where head is turned off/on (0xFF here) 47-51 self synch 0xFFs (6 bytes actually written to media) 52 0xD5 53 0xAA 54 0xAD 55 spare byte, generally diskbytes[(sector number)] 56-754 "nibblized" sector data ... 755-758 checksum 759 0xDE 760 0xAA 761 pad byte where head is turned off (0xFF here) MFM Track layout for 1440K disks: Pos --------- track ID 0 0x4E (x80) 80 00 (x12) 92 C2 (x3) Mark byte 93 FC Index mark 94 4E (x50) --------- sector ID 144 00 (x12) 156 A1 (x3) Mark byte 159 FE Address mark 160 xx Track number 161 xx Side number 162 xx Sector number 163 xx Sector length 164/165 xx CRC 166 4E (x22) --------- sector data 188 00 (x12) 200 A1 (x3) Mark byte 203 FB Data address mark 204 xx (x256) data 460 4E (x54) (repeat from sector ID to fill track; end of track is padded with 4E) Note : "Self synch refers to a technique whereby two zeroes are inserted between each synch byte written to the disk.", i.e. "0xFF, 0xFF, 0xFF, 0xFF, 0xFF" is actually "0xFF, 0x3F, 0xCF, 0xF3, 0xFC, 0xFF" on disk. Since the IWM assumes the data transfer is complete when the MSBit of its shift register is 1, we do read 4 0xFF, even though they are not contiguous on the disk media. Some reflexion shows that 4 synch bytes allow the IWM to synchronize with the trailing data. Format byte codes: 0x00 Apple II 0x01 Lisa 0x02 Mac MFS (single sided)? 0x22 Mac MFS (double sided)? *********************************************************************/ #include #include #include "emu.h" // logerror #include "ap_dsk35.h" struct apple35_tag { uint32_t data_offset;
